Samara Establishes New Commemorative Day for Military Veterans
The Samara Regional Duma passed a law establishing July 1st as the "Day of Veterans of Military Actions," an initiative spearheaded by veterans to honor their service and foster patriotism, following similar regional practices across Russia.

Macron and Lombard Urge French Businesses to Unite Against US Tariffs
French President Macron and Economy Minister Eric Lombard urged French businesses to unite against US tariffs, advocating for collective action and patriotism to counter the economic effects of the trade dispute, predicting a return to negotiations.

Canadian Rage Against US Policies: Boycotts, Unity, and Uncertain Future
In response to rising tensions with the U.S., Canadians are actively boycotting American goods, cancelling travel plans, and boosting domestic businesses, showcasing a unified national sentiment expressed through the "elbows up" slogan; the impact remains to be seen.

National Medal of Honor Museum Opens in Texas
The National Medal of Honor Museum opened in Arlington, Texas on March 25, 2024, showcasing the stories of 3,547 service members who received the Medal of Honor, the highest military decoration for valor, aiming to inspire through their courage and sacrifice.

Stele Honors Fallen Soldiers of Special Military Operation in Vladivostok
A stele honoring Primorsky Krai residents killed in the Special Military Operation was unveiled at Vladivostok's Maritime Cemetery on May 1, 2025, featuring a warrior figure and cranes symbolizing fallen soldiers, within a memorial complex established in April 2024.
